Product Management Improvement Question: Enhancing Vivid Money's investment platform for novice investors

Introduction

To make Vivid Money's investment platform more accessible for beginner investors, we need to focus on simplifying the onboarding process, providing educational resources, and creating a user-friendly interface. I'll approach this challenge by first understanding our target users and their pain points, then generating solutions that address these issues while aligning with Vivid Money's business goals.

Step 1

Clarifying Questions (5 mins)

  • Looking at the product context, I'm thinking Vivid Money might be targeting young professionals who are new to investing. Could you help me understand the primary demographic and psychographic characteristics of our target "beginner investors"?

Why it matters: This will help tailor our solutions to the specific needs and preferences of our target audience. Expected answer: Young professionals, 25-35 years old, tech-savvy but with limited financial knowledge. Impact on approach: Would focus on mobile-first, educational features with a modern UI.

  • Considering user behavior, I'm curious about the current onboarding process. What are the key steps a new user goes through when signing up, and where do we see the highest drop-off rates?

Why it matters: Identifies immediate pain points in the user journey that need addressing. Expected answer: High drop-off during identity verification and initial fund transfer steps. Impact on approach: Would prioritize streamlining these processes and providing more guidance.

  • Regarding product lifecycle, where does Vivid Money's investment platform currently stand, and what are the key metrics driving this improvement initiative?

Why it matters: Helps align our solutions with the overall product strategy and business goals. Expected answer: Early growth phase, focusing on user acquisition and engagement metrics. Impact on approach: Would balance between features for new user acquisition and those encouraging regular platform use.

  • In terms of external factors, how does Vivid Money's offering compare to key competitors in the market, particularly in terms of features for beginner investors?

Why it matters: Identifies potential gaps in the market and areas for differentiation. Expected answer: Competitors offer more educational content but have higher minimum investment requirements. Impact on approach: Would focus on creating a unique value proposition combining accessibility with education.
